The role

As a Senior Regional Sales Manager, you’ll:

  • Lead regional clusters to deliver commercial, operational, and customer performance targets
  • Coach, develop, and support Cluster Managers and regional leadership teams
  • Drive sales growth, productivity, and continuous improvement across the region
  • Monitor KPIs and implement strategies to improve underperformance
  • Conduct regular cluster and store visits to assess performance and provide coaching
  • Ensure exceptional levels of customer care and service quality across all locations
  • Support recruitment, succession planning, and talent development across the region
  • Manage regional budgets and operational performance
  • Identify opportunities for growth, revenue improvement, and cost efficiencies
  • Support network planning, including new store openings and operational changes
  • Lead engagement initiatives and help foster a high-performance culture aligned to Sonova values
  • Handle escalated operational, customer, and people-related issues effectively

You’ll be trusted to lead from the front, influence performance, and drive a culture of accountability, engagement, and continuous improvement.

How to prepare for a job interview at Boots Hearingcare

Know Your Numbers

As a Senior Regional Sales Manager, you'll need to be on top of your KPIs and performance metrics. Before the interview, brush up on relevant statistics from your previous roles—think sales growth percentages, team performance improvements, and customer satisfaction scores. Being able to discuss these figures confidently will show that you understand the importance of data in driving operational success.

Showcase Your Leadership Style

This role is all about leading teams and driving performance. Prepare examples of how you've coached and developed teams in the past. Think about specific challenges you faced and how you overcame them. Highlighting your leadership style and how it aligns with fostering a high-performance culture will resonate well with the interviewers.

Understand the Business Landscape

Familiarise yourself with Boots Hearingcare and its position within the healthcare retail sector. Research their recent initiatives, values, and any news related to the company. This knowledge will not only help you answer questions more effectively but also demonstrate your genuine interest in the role and the company.

Prepare for Scenario Questions

Expect to face scenario-based questions that assess your problem-solving and decision-making skills. Think about potential challenges you might encounter in this role, such as managing underperforming clusters or handling escalated customer issues. Prepare structured responses using the STAR method (Situation, Task, Action, Result) to clearly articulate your thought process and solutions.
